LOWER PAXTON TOWNSHIP, Pa.–Police are looking for two women accused of stealing items from a beauty store in Dauphin County on Christmas eve.

The theft occurred at Ulta located along the 5100 block of Jonestown Road in Lower Paxton Township on Dec. 24.

Investigators say two women were caught on camera concealing multiple items in large bags before leaving the store without paying. The pair were seen leaving the parking lot in a white sedan.

A reward of up to $2,000 is being offered by Dauphin County Crime Stoppers.

If you have information relating to their identity call 1-800-262-3080. Tipsters can remain anonymous.
